Compliance with the WHO Global Code of Practice:

 

We are committed to complying with the WHO Global Code of Practice on the International Recruitment of Health Personnel. In particular, we do not recruit in countries that are listed on the currently applicable WHO health workforce support and safeguards list.

compliance with international human rights standards

 

 

We are committed to complying with international human rights standards, including:

 

  • The ILO core labor standards,

  • The ILO General principles and operational guidelines for fair recruitment and definition of recruitment fees and related costs,

  • The United Nations Guiding Principles on Business and Human Rights,

  • As well as international UN human rights agreements.

  • IRIS standards (International Organization of Migration)

 

employer pays principle

 

The specialists are not charged any direct or indirect placement fees or costs for services directly related to the placement. This applies to the entire service chain.

 

 

waiver of commitment and repayment obligations

 

We waive commitment and repayment obligations in the placement contracts with the specialists. We do not place people in employment contracts that contain commitment and repayment obligations that relate to the costs of the placement.
